Description

The document outlines an Answer and Affirmative Defenses form used in civil lawsuit actions within the United States. This legal form enables the defendant to respond formally to the allegations made in a complaint filed against them, presenting specific defenses. Key features of the form include structured sections for stating the defendant's identity, admitting or denying allegations, and outlining affirmative defenses such as laches. Filling instructions emphasize clarity, requiring users to specify dates and claims while ensuring responses are made thoughtfully. The form serves various legal professionals, including attorneys who may represent clients in litigation, paralegals who assist in form preparation, and legal assistants who manage documentation. It is tailored to facilitate a clear and organized response, crucial for preserving the defendant's rights and effectively contesting the plaintiff's claims. A civil case generally proceeds through a series of organized stages. After the filing of a complaint, both parties will engage in discovery, exchanging information pertinent to the case. If no settlement is reached, the case will move to trial where evidence and arguments are presented. Yes, you can file a lawsuit against the United States under specific circumstances. This process often falls under the Federal Tort Claims Act, which allows individuals to seek compensation for certain wrongful acts committed by federal employees.
